Unveiling The Truth: Do Magnetic Massage Insoles Really Deliver?

do magnetic massage insoles really work

Magnetic massage insoles have gained popularity as a potential solution for foot pain and discomfort. These insoles are designed with built-in magnets that are believed to provide a massaging effect and improve circulation in the feet. But do they really work? While some users swear by their effectiveness, the scientific evidence supporting their benefits is limited. Studies have shown mixed results, with some indicating that magnetic insoles may provide temporary relief for certain types of foot pain, while others suggest that they have no significant impact on pain or circulation. It's important to note that individual experiences may vary, and the effectiveness of magnetic massage insoles may depend on factors such as the severity of foot pain, the type of insole used, and the duration of use. As with any health-related product, it's advisable to consult with a healthcare professional before trying magnetic massage insoles, especially if you have underlying medical conditions or concerns.

Effectiveness of Magnetic Therapy: Exploring the scientific evidence behind magnetic therapy and its impact on pain relief and overall health

Magnetic therapy has been touted for its potential benefits in pain relief and overall health improvement. But what does the scientific evidence say about its effectiveness? Studies on magnetic therapy have yielded mixed results, with some research suggesting that it may help alleviate pain and improve sleep quality, while other studies have found no significant benefits.

One of the challenges in evaluating the effectiveness of magnetic therapy is the lack of standardization in the types and strengths of magnets used, as well as the duration and frequency of treatment. Additionally, many studies have been small and poorly designed, making it difficult to draw definitive conclusions.

Despite these limitations, some researchers believe that magnetic therapy may work by affecting the body's electromagnetic fields, potentially influencing the flow of blood and the activity of nerves. However, more high-quality research is needed to fully understand the mechanisms behind magnetic therapy and its potential effects on the body.

In the context of magnetic massage insoles, the evidence is similarly inconclusive. While some users report experiencing pain relief and improved comfort when using these insoles, there is limited scientific data to support these claims. A small study published in the Journal of Alternative and Complementary Medicine found that magnetic insoles may help reduce foot pain in people with plantar fasciitis, but larger, more rigorous studies are needed to confirm these findings.

Ultimately, the effectiveness of magnetic therapy and magnetic massage insoles remains a topic of debate. While some people may experience benefits from using these treatments, others may not. As with any alternative therapy, it is important to consult with a healthcare professional before trying magnetic therapy, especially if you have a medical condition or are taking medications.

How Magnetic Insoles Work: Understanding the mechanism by which magnetic insoles are believed to improve circulation and reduce discomfort

Magnetic insoles operate on the principle of magnetotherapy, a form of alternative medicine that utilizes magnetic fields to promote healing and alleviate pain. The insoles are embedded with small magnets that create a magnetic field around the foot. Proponents of magnetic insoles believe that this magnetic field can improve blood circulation, reduce inflammation, and relieve discomfort associated with various foot conditions.

The mechanism by which magnetic insoles are believed to improve circulation is through the stimulation of blood vessels. The magnetic field is thought to cause the blood vessels to dilate, allowing for increased blood flow to the affected area. This increased circulation can help to deliver more oxygen and nutrients to the tissues, promoting healing and reducing pain.

In addition to improving circulation, magnetic insoles are also believed to reduce discomfort by alleviating pressure points and promoting relaxation. The magnetic field can help to relax the muscles and tendons in the foot, reducing tension and pain. Furthermore, the insoles can help to redistribute weight more evenly across the foot, reducing pressure on specific areas and providing relief from discomfort.

While the theory behind magnetic insoles is intriguing, it is important to note that the scientific evidence supporting their effectiveness is limited. Many studies on magnetotherapy have been inconclusive, and more research is needed to fully understand the potential benefits and risks associated with magnetic insoles. However, for individuals seeking alternative treatments for foot pain and discomfort, magnetic insoles may be a viable option to consider.

Comparison with Other Treatments: Evaluating how magnetic insoles compare to other alternative treatments for foot pain, such as orthotic insoles or physical therapy

Magnetic insoles are often compared to orthotic insoles and physical therapy as alternative treatments for foot pain. While orthotic insoles are designed to correct biomechanical issues and provide support, magnetic insoles are marketed with the claim of using magnetic fields to alleviate pain and improve circulation. Physical therapy, on the other hand, involves exercises and manual treatments to strengthen muscles and improve flexibility.

Studies have shown that orthotic insoles can be effective in reducing foot pain, especially for conditions like plantar fasciitis and flat feet. They work by redistributing pressure and providing support to the foot's natural arch. In contrast, the evidence supporting the effectiveness of magnetic insoles is less conclusive. Some small studies suggest that magnetic fields may have a positive effect on pain and inflammation, but more research is needed to confirm these findings.

Physical therapy is a more comprehensive approach to treating foot pain, as it addresses the underlying causes and not just the symptoms. It can be particularly beneficial for those with chronic pain or injuries. However, it requires a significant time commitment and may not be as convenient as using insoles.

When considering these treatments, it's important to weigh the pros and cons of each. Orthotic insoles are generally safe and can be used in conjunction with other treatments, but they may not address the root cause of the pain. Magnetic insoles are a newer technology with limited research, and their long-term effects are not well understood. Physical therapy can be effective but may be costly and time-consuming.

Ultimately, the best treatment for foot pain will depend on the individual's specific condition and preferences. It may be helpful to consult with a healthcare professional to determine the most appropriate course of action.

Generally, magnetic massage insoles are considered safe for most people to use. However, individuals with pacemakers or other implanted medical devices should avoid them, as the magnets could potentially interfere with these devices. Additionally, some users may experience discomfort or irritation in their feet when first using the insoles, but this usually subsides with regular use.
